You can change the number of images displayed at the same time, or
display the images by shooting date.
1
Press the M button in Step 1 on p.180.
The display style selection screen appears.
2
Use the four-way controller
(2345) to select the display
style.
4/9/16/36/81 Thumbnail Display
Icons such as C and ? are displayed with
images (except in 81 Thumbnail Display).
Calendar Filmstrip Display
Images are grouped and displayed by the
shooting date.
